Stranded in the perilous, uncharted waters of the South Pacific, a desperate rescue mission inadvertently breaches the barrier of a mysterious landmass known as Skull Island. Led by the pragmatic captain Cap, the crew seeks to save Annie, a traumatized young girl they pulled from the ocean. However, their salvation is short-lived when a violent storm shatters their vessel, scattering the survivors across a lush, hyper-evolutionary nightmare. Driven by a fierce paternal instinct, Cap’s primary motivation is securing Annie’s safety, unaware that the island’s brutal ecosystem views the newcomers as little more than intrusive prey.Concurrently, a cynical and reckless castaway named Charlie finds himself crossing paths with the newcomers. Having survived on the island for years, Charlie is driven entirely by self-preservation and a cynical detachment from
human connection, though he is reluctantly drawn into the group’s chaotic dynamic. As the survivors navigate dense jungles teeming with grotesque prehistoric monstrosities and venomous flora, the island’s true apex predator emerges: a colossal, golden-furred ape known as Kong. Revered by the island’s enigmatic, masked native inhabitants as a sacred protector, Kong views the intrusion of the outsiders—and the
advanced technology they carry—with immediate hostility.A high-stakes game of cat and mouse ensues as the group is hunted relentlessly not only by Kong, but by a gargantuan, ancient sea-serpent dwelling in the island's murky depths. This terrifying leviathan serves as Kong’s ancient nemesis, threatening to disrupt the fragile ecological balance of the island. Amidst the carnage, personal demons surface. Cap grapples with the guilt of his past failures as a father, while Annie begins exhibiting strange, unexplainable connections to the island’s mystical energy and to Kong himself, hinting that her presence on the ocean was no accident.As alliances fracture under the immense psychological and physical toll of the jungle, the survivors realize that escaping the island requires more than just a repaired boat; it demands confronting the very nature of human greed and aggression. The climax culminates in a cataclysmic battle when the sea-serpent breaches the island's inner sanctuary, forcing Kong into a brutal, earth-shattering war for dominance. In the fiery aftermath, Cap makes the ultimate sacrifice to ensure Annie and the surviving crew can escape on a makeshift raft, leaving Charlie forever changed by his newfound humanity. As the horizon swallows the fading silhouette of Skull Island, Kong watches from a rocky precipice, remaining the eternal, tragic king of a forgotten world, while Annie gazes back, forever bonded to the beast and the haunting secrets left buried in the jungle.
